Julien joins us to talk about the excesses in the DeFi space and how the ecosystem should cope with them.Topics covered...2021-03-031h 23Epicenter - Learn about Crypto, Blockchain, Ethereum, Bitcoin and Distributed TechnologiesEpicenter - Learn about Crypto, Blockchain, Ethereum, Bitcoin and Distributed TechnologiesTieshun Roquerre: Namebase – Decentralizing DNS and Certificate AuthoritiesNamebase is a top-level domain (TLD) name registrar that operates on the Handshake blockchain. It creates an ecosystem of TLDs that may be bought and sold using an on-chain auction mechanism. It takes a different approach to other decentralized domain name systems as Namebase is compatible with the ICANN namespace, the organization governs domain names globally. Users may register TLDs that don't yet exist in the ICANN namespace, like .epicenter or .ethereum, for example, creating the opportunity for new niche domain registrars to emerge. We also discuss how...2019-06-211h 35Epicenter - Learn about Crypto, Blockchain, Ethereum, Bitcoin and Distributed TechnologiesEpicenter - Learn about Crypto, Blockchain, Ethereum, Bitcoin and Distributed TechnologiesDan Robinson: Rainbow Network – Off-Chain Synthetics Exchange or “Multicolored Lightning”We’re joined by Dan Robinson, a research partner at Paradigm, and the author the “Rainbow Network” paper. The paper describes an off-chain decentralized synthetics exchange which leverages payment channels. The Rainbow Network is based on the idea that “rainbows are basically just multicolored lightning,” borrowing from the concepts used in the Lightning Network. The protocol relies on trusted oracles and allows participants to trade any type of liquid asset off-chain. All that is necessary to complete a transaction is an on-chain payment channel collateralized by a single asset.
